在网络世界中,我们经常需要从各种网站上下载数据、图片或者软件,而wget,作为一款强大的命令行工具,被广泛用于下载HTTP和FTP文件,有时候我们可能会遇到一些问题,比如下载速度慢、无法下载某些文件等,这时候,就需要我们对wget进行一些修改,以适应我们的需要,本文将介绍如何修改wget的参数,以满足不同的下载需求。
wget的基本使用
我们需要了解wget的基本使用方法,wget是一个命令行工具,用于下载文件,它支持多种协议,包括HTTP、HTTPS、FTP等,要使用wget下载文件,只需在命令行中输入以下格式的命令:
wget [选项] [URL]
要下载一个名为example.txt的文件,可以使用以下命令:
wget https://example.com/example.txt
修改wget的参数
- 下载速度:如果下载速度过慢,可以尝试调整wget的
--no-check-certificate或--no-check-certificate-cache选项,这将禁用证书检查,从而加快下载速度。
wget --no-check-certificate https://example.com/example.txt
- 下载范围:有时我们只需要下载文件的一部分,而不是整个文件,这时,可以使用
--in-range选项来指定下载范围,要从https://example.com/example.txt下载第500字节到第1000字节的内容,可以使用以下命令:
wget --in-range=500:1000 https://example.com/example.txt
- 代理设置:在某些情况下,可能需要使用代理服务器来加速下载,这时,可以使用
--proxy选项来指定代理服务器,如果要使用代理服务器下载example.txt文件,可以使用以下命令:
wget --proxy http://proxy.example.com https://example.com/example.txt
- 其他选项:除了上述选项外,wget还支持许多其他选项,如
--reject-non-existent-redirects(拒绝无效重定向)、--tries-max=N(最大重试次数)等,可以根据实际需求进行调整。
通过以上介绍,我们可以看到,wget是一个非常强大的命令行工具,可以满足我们大部分的下载需求,有时候我们可能需要对其进行一些修改,以适应特定的下载场景。

总浏览